Jamin

This intimate if rather frilly restaurant where Joël Robuchon made his name serves brilliant food well away from the media spotlight. The best value is the lunch prix-fixe at EUR50, which entitles you to a generous meal with extras such as the sorbet trolley. The dinner prix-fixes at EUR95 and EUR130 also compare favorably with the offerings at other restaurants of Jamin's caliber. Benoît Guichard, Robuchon's second for many years, is a particularly marvelous saucier (sauce maker). The menu changes regularly, but Guichard favors dishes with a Mediterranean touch, such as sea bass with pistachios in fennel sauce and braised beef with cumin-scented carrots. The seasonal gratin of rhubarb with a red-fruit sauce makes an excellent dessert. Reservations essential. Métro: Iéna.
